Digital assets can take many forms. For example, currencies, securities, or commodities can become digital assets. Other examples include cryptocurrencies, such as Bitcoin, or the issuance of a stock or bond on the Distributed ledger technology (DLT) platform. Another example is partial ownership of property.
Digital asset custodians are quickly becoming the first link between the traditional and digital asset worlds. Similar to classic institutions, these custodians effectively hold on to digital assets, so users and customers don’t need to worry about the complexity of private keys or digital wallets.

Cybercrime is a criminal activity that either targets or uses a computer, a computer network, or a device connected to the network.
